Research Activities

  • Reconstructing the glacial history and climate change record from Quaternary terrestrial and marine sedimentary sequences. Collection and analysis of high-resolution seismic data from fjord and continental shelf sedimentary sequences; lithologic and sedimentologic analysis of marine sediment cores (A, B, C).
  • Modeling former ice sheets and fjord-outlet glaciers from seismic- and litho- stratigraphic studies (A, B, C).
  • Geomorphology and evolution of surface environments of the terrestrial planets.
  • Geologic history and evolution of Mars atmosphere.
  • Hydrogeologic studies of glacial deposits in the upper midwest and related environmental problems. Geomorphological process studies and terrain analysis using Digital Elevation Models (D).
